Where is Toowoomba?

Toowoomba is a city in south-east Queensland, Australia. It is located 127 km (79 mi) west of Brisbane, Queensland's capital city.

Is Uluru located in Queensland?

No. The Australian landform known as Uluru is in the Northern Territory. It is located in the far south of the Territory. The state of Queensland is directly east of the Northern Territory.
